海外云服务器索引备份的核心需求与挑战
随着企业业务向海外拓展,海外云服务器的索引数据面临多重风险与要求。索引数据作为支撑核心业务的关键资产,一旦丢失或损坏,将直接导致搜索功能瘫痪、用户体验下降甚至品牌声誉受损。,某跨境电商平台曾因海外服务器硬件故障导致用户搜索功能中断3小时,直接损失超百万美元,这凸显了索引备份的必要性。从合规角度看,不同地区对数据备份要求差异显著,如欧盟GDPR要求个人数据备份需满足“数据可携带权”和“被遗忘权”,美国部分州对跨境数据传输有严格限制,这些都要求备份策略需兼顾本地法规与国际合规标准。
业务连续性方面,索引数据的恢复速度直接影响RTO(恢复时间目标)和RPO(恢复点目标)。对于金融、电商等核心场景,RTO通常要求分钟级响应(如支付平台索引故障可能导致交易中断),RPO需控制在小时级甚至分钟级(如实时数据分析依赖最新索引)。海外云服务器的地理分布可能带来数据传输延迟问题,中国数据备份至北美服务器时,跨洋网络波动可能导致备份耗时过长;而成本控制则需平衡存储资源(海外存储成本通常高于本地)与备份效果,避免预算超支。
基于海外云服务器的索引备份策略设计
针对上述需求与挑战,海外云服务器索引备份需构建“多层次、高可用、强安全”的体系,核心包括数据分层备份、多副本冗余、加密防护及容灾恢复机制。
数据分层备份是基础。考虑到索引数据的更新频率和重要性,可采用“全量+增量+实时日志”组合策略:全量备份(如每日凌晨)对整个索引库完整备份,适合数据量较大、更新不频繁的场景;增量备份(如每小时)针对新增/变更数据块,减少存储与传输资源消耗;实时日志备份通过捕获索引操作日志(如增删改记录),实现RPO接近0,满足核心业务的高实时性需求(如某国际新闻网站采用该策略,实现索引数据零丢失,RTO控制<15分钟)。
多副本冗余保障高可用与容灾能力。在海外云服务器的不同可用区(AZ)或地理区域部署备份副本,可应对单点故障风险。,
AWS多区域复制(MR)功能可将索引同步至至少3个区域,Azure地理冗余存储(GRS)将数据存储在主备区域,实现跨区域容灾;副本间需通过哈希值比对、时间戳同步确保数据一致性,避免备份数据与源数据偏差。
加密与访问控制是数据安全的核心。索引数据可能包含用户ID、交易记录等敏感信息,需在传输与存储环节全程加密:传输加密采用SSL/TLS协议,防止备份数据从海外服务器传输至备份存储时被窃听;存储加密通过云厂商加密服务(如AWS KMS、Azure Key Vault)对备份文件加密,密钥由企业自主管理;访问控制遵循“最小权限原则”,仅授权管理员通过多因素认证(MFA)访问,限制操作权限(如仅允许恢复,禁止删除),防止内部人员恶意破坏。
索引备份的实施步骤与工具选择
有效的策略需通过规范实施步骤落地,同时合理工具可提升备份效率。基于海外云服务器的索引备份实施分四步:需求分析、环境配置、工具选型、监控优化。
需求分析阶段需明确业务目标:评估数据量(单库大小、日变更量)、更新频率(实时/批量)、恢复要求(RTO/RPO)及合规法规(如GDPR、HIPAA);确定备份范围(全量索引/关键字段);制定预算(平衡存储成本与性能成本,如选择S3 Infrequent Access低成本存储)。,某跨境支付平台通过分析,确定每日全量+15分钟增量备份,RTO<30分钟,RPO<5分钟,预算控制在月均1万美元内。
环境配置需选择合适厂商与资源:若需多区域容灾,AWS(99个可用区)或Azure(6个地理区域)更优;若侧重成本,Google Cloud连续数据保护(CDP)功能性价比更高。配置时需注意带宽,避免因带宽不足导致备份超时,可通过增加带宽或选择业务低峰期(如凌晨)执行全量备份。
工具选型需结合索引类型与需求:云厂商原生工具(如AWS Backup)适合非技术团队,支持自动存储类别选择;第三方工具(如Veeam)适合跨平台备份,支持细粒度恢复;开源工具(如rsync+脚本)适合技术团队自定义逻辑。需确保工具支持海外云服务器API调用(如AWS SDK),实现自动化流程。
监控与优化是长期保障:部署Prometheus+Grafana监控备份成功率、存储使用率等指标,设置告警阈值(如失败率>5%触发邮件通知);定期恢复演练,测试RTO是否达标,如发现问题(如恢复耗时过长)及时调整策略(如优化脚本或增加资源);关注云厂商服务更新(如AWS BaaS),引入新技术提升效率。